It's wise to maintain records of invoices, images, video clips and all communication with your insurance company. File the dates, names and conversation information associated with the case process in your log. If you require to remember details case information, you'll have the information conveniently offered. As you take photos, take down the kind of damage, estimated worth and approximate acquisition date, if you can remember. The regulations of supply and need start, causing high rate walkings on lots of products and services, making the price to repair and restore homes greater. Specialists anticipate that the regularity of severe weather will cause home insurance coverage costs to remain to climb in 2023 and in future years.
